How a fixed-rate mortgage works

You can easily budget around your mortgage costs with a fixed-rate mortgage. Your rate will stay the same each month, whatever happens to interest rates generally, until a set date, usually two, three or five years ahead.

    Annual Percentage Rate (APR)

    APR stands for Annual Percentage Rate and takes into account all the costs of a loan – giving you the overall cost for comparison. An APR is calculated in a standard way to allow you to compare different mortgage offers, including those from other lenders. The APR includes important factors such as:

    • the initial interest rate you must pay,
    • how you repay the loan,
    • the full length of the mortgage term,
    • frequency and timing of mortgage payments,
    • certain fees associated with the mortgage.

    It is important to remember that these APRs are calculated using average figures so each individual loan will have slightly different APR. The actual APR that will apply to your mortgage will be calculated when you get a personalised quote.

    Early repayment charge (ERC)

    A charge payable on certain types of loan if it is repaid or partly repaid within a certain period eg during a fixed-rate period or while a discount applies.
